  • It achive maximum altitude of 60° at noon.
  • X-Axis: Horizontal axis indicates time passing from 00:00 hours to 24:00 hours.
  • Y-Axis: Vertical axis indicates altitude -90 degree to +90 degree.
  • The graph show sun altitude with time during a day. Horizontal line is the line showing horizan. Sun rise, Solar Noon and Sun set are shown as vertical line crossing the line of horizan.
  • Between -6° to sunrise it is Civil twilight
  • Between -12° to -6° it is Nautical twilight
  • Between -18° to -12° it is Astro twilight
